What time of day is it best to take Flomax?

Answers

m42orion 12 Oct 2009

My urologist told me (and it is not on the prescription but only verbally) to try to take my 0.4 mg capsule about "1/2 hour or so" after the same meal each day. The same time was the most important part. (I take 5 other pills, all to be taken at bedtime, so, I don't follow his advise always, sadly, as I am not always able to remember. At least I have the same time part down. But, it seems to work just fine.) Hope this helps.

It may depend on the side effects. If insomnia is a side effect, then taking it in the morning would be best. Other side effects may be better to have while you are sleeping so in that case taking it in the evening would make sense.
